Product Introduction

  1. Definition: Reve 2.0 is an advanced AI image generation and editing platform that utilizes a proprietary, layout-based foundational model. It falls under the technical category of generative AI for visual content, specifically a Large Layout Model (LLM) designed for precise compositional control.
  2. Core Value Proposition: Reve 2.0 eliminates the inherent ambiguity of text-to-image generation by replacing prose prompts with a structured, addressable layout system. This provides users with unparalleled pixel-level control and nonverbal visual instruction capabilities for creating and editing 4K images, making it the ideal tool for professional design workflows and marketing asset production.

Main Features

  1. Layout-First Generation Model: The core technology is a unified model that interprets hierarchical layout structures instead of expanded text descriptions. It takes any combination of layouts, natural language instructions, and reference images as input, performs internal spatial reasoning, and renders final pixels. This structured representation acts as an "image backbone," similar to how HTML defines a webpage.
  2. Precise Compositional Control & Editing: Users can specify the exact location, size, style, and content for every discrete region within an image. The model supports nonverbal control through direct layout editing and language-guided refinement. This enables targeted image editing and complex scene reconstruction with high fidelity, achieving a CLIP similarity score of up to 0.929 with sufficient regions.
  3. Unified Agentic Model Architecture: Built on a novel data pipeline processed from billions of images and enhanced with continued pretraining of open-source LLMs (like Qwen), the model possesses advanced spatial reasoning capabilities. It functions as an agentic system for both visual understanding and generation, seamlessly translating abstract compositional intent into high-quality visuals.

Unique Advantages

  1. Differentiation: Unlike conventional text-to-image diffusion models (e.g., DALL-E, Midjourney) that rely on LLM-expanded prose prompts, Reve 2.0 operates on a structured layout interface. This fundamental shift provides deterministic control over composition, moving from ambiguous description to precise spatial programming.
  2. Key Innovation: The primary innovation is the layout-based intermediate representation coupled with a purpose-built Large Layout Model. This approach decouples semantic intent from pixel rendering, enabling the model to achieve superior reconstruction quality and generation quality that scale with both model size and the granularity of the layout (region count). It is trained on 10x fewer GPUs while achieving state-of-the-art performance among sub-$1T companies.
